South Main Street - streets of Joanna (South Carolina).
Explore "South Main Street" on the map of Joanna in street view mode
Click on the buttons below to display the map of South Main Street, Joanna, United States
Search street by name:
Tags:
South Main Street on the map of Joanna,
Joanna satellite view, Joanna street view.